Polar Force 20-1
U.S. Air Force Staff Sgt. Garrett Lucas, 673d Communications Squadron radio frequency supervisor of forward support for Agile Communications support, connects communications equipment for Agile Combat Employment (ACE) assembly during a Polar Force (PF) 20-1 exercise at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son, Alaska, Sept. 30, 2019. PF 20-1 is designed to exercise multiple elements of the ACE concept of operations. These elements include generating fifth-generation combat power from austere locations, command and control using non-traditional methods, and rapid airlift capabilities to sustain a forward operating location. The ACE concept enables the 3rd Wing to deliver lethal airpower for the United States, even in a contested environment.
